Quadrature Sensors provide two 90º out of phase digital outputs to record speed and direction of travel of gear teeth or other ferrous targets past the sensor.

Hall effect circuitry measures speed accurately to true zero, direction of rotation or travel, and true angular position of gear. Built to stand up to hostile environments, including a wide range of operating temperatures.
